How is melasma treated?

Melasma is treated using a combination of topical medications, procedures, and diligent sun protection, tailored to the individual’s skin type and severity of pigmentation.

Here are the most common treatment methods for melasma:

    Topical Treatment

    Excess melanin production can lead to dark patches on the skin, a common symptom of melasma. Topical medications work by inhibiting melanin production. Here are some of the most common topical melasma treatments for Indian skin. Remember to always consult your dermatologist before starting any treatments or creams.

    1. Hydroquinone: Hydroquinone inhibits the activity of tyrosinase, an enzyme involved in melanin production. By inhibiting tyrosinase, hydroquinone can reduce the amount of melanin produced, which can help lighten the skin and reduce the appearance of melasma.
    1. Tretinoin: Tretinoin is a form of vitamin A that helps to speed up skin cell turnover. By increasing the rate at which skin cells are shed and replaced, tretinoin can help reduce the amount of melanin produced.
    1. Kojic Acid: Kojic acid is an effective melasma treatment for Indian skin. It works by inhibiting the activity of tyrosinase, which can reduce the amount of melanin produced.
    1. Azelaic Acid: Like tretinoin, Azelaic acid works by speeding up skin cell turnover. This can help reduce melanin production and the inflammation contributing to melasma.

      Chemical Peel

      A chemical peel is a cosmetic melasma treatment in Pune that involves the application of a chemical solution to the skin to exfoliate the outermost layer and reveal smoother, brighter, and more even-toned skin underneath.

      Chemical peels are often used to treat a range of skin concerns, including acne, fine lines and wrinkles, melasma, and sun damage. They can be performed on the face, neck, chest, and hands.

      Several types of chemical peels, including glycolic acid, Trichloroacetic acid peel, Retinoic acid peel, or combination peels, are used for melasma treatment.

      Let’s see how to get rid of melasma with chemical peels. The chemical solution is applied to the skin during the procedure and left on for a specific time. The time the solution is left on the skin depends on the type of peel being used and the individual’s skin type.

      Chemical peels are not suitable for everyone, and people can experience irritation and redness for a few days after treatment. Some individuals can also experience peeling. However, by consulting with a board-certified dermatologist, these side effects can be minimised.

      Microdermabrasion

      Microdermabrasion is a non-invasive cosmetic procedure that uses a specific device to exfoliate the outer layer of the skin gently. This can help reduce melasma’s appearance by removing the top layer of hyperpigmented skin. It can help improve the appearance of fine lines, wrinkles, acne scars, and sun damage.

      Laser Therapy

      Laser therapy is another popular melasma treatment. This treatment uses a specific type of laser that targets the melanin in the skin, breaking it down and reducing the appearance of dark patches. 

      Q-switched Nd:YAG 1064 nm laser can be an effective treatment option for people with melasma, especially those with darker skin. 

      However, it is important to note that laser treatment alone may not provide optimal results for everyone. For the best outcome, it may need to be combined with other procedures, such as chemical peels, topical creams, and oral medications.

      Sun Protection

      Sun protection is key for melasma. Sun makes melasma worse, so always use sunscreen with at least SPF 30 and UVA protection. Try to stay out of the sun for long periods.

      Melasma can be tricky to treat, and it might take a few months to see changes. Always talk to a skin doctor (dermatologist) before starting any treatment. They can help you find the best plan.
